I will have nought to do with a man who can blow hot and cold with the same breath.
Kindness is more persuasive than force.
It is foolish to try to imitate the skills of others.
It is possible to have too much of a good thing.
Familiarity breeds contempt.
It pays to be prepared.
He that always gives way to others will end in having no principles of his own.
Vices are their own punishment
It is thrifty to prepare today for the wants of tomorrow.
Never trust the advice of a man in difficulties.
We would often be sorry if our wishes were gratified.
Do not count your chickens before they are hatched.
Example is the best precept.
The smaller the mind the greater the conceit.
Little by little does the trick.
